HVAC work in Lumberton requires licensed technicians familiar with New Mexico codes. Before hiring, confirm they're EPA 608 certified for refrigerant handling and ask about warranty coverage on parts and labor.

Tune-ups run $75–$200, AC repair $150–$600, and full system replacement $4,000–$12,000. Prices in Lumberton may vary based on the scope of work and provider.

✅ Tips for Hiring HVAC Contractors in Lumberton

Ask about SEER ratings for new equipment
Check for manufacturer-certified technicians
Ask about maintenance plan discounts
Verify EPA 608 certification
